GENERAL CURRICULUM SPECIAL EDUCATION TEACHERS - These are full-time positions in co-teaching classrooms. Exact school(s) and grade level / content areas have yet to be determined and may be determined based on candidate qualifications and expertise. Applicants must either hold a clear renewable certificate in special education general curriculum or be eligible to hold a certificate in special education general curriculum. Candidates should have experience and / or knowledge of IEPs, and co-teaching models and be knowledgeable of learning and instructional strategies for assisting students in reaching their full potential. TITLE : Teacher, Special Education
CATEGORY : Certified
SALARY : Georgia State Salary Scale & Applicable Supplements
FLSA EXEMPT : Yes
JOB GOAL : To teach assigned students those skills, concepts, attitudes, and abilities as directed in adopted curriculum, and to perform other duties ancillary to the teaching role to include student safety, control, welfare, and growth.
REPORTS TO : Principal
QUALIFICATIONS / REQUIREMENTS :
- Valid Georgia teaching certificate required in appropriate field or meets local Professional Qualifications.
- Ability to relate well to individuals, groups of students, and parents.
- Physical demands - position requires significant standing and some sitting, kneeling, and walking. Lifting, carrying, pushing or pulling will not normally exceed thirty (30) pounds, and will usually be in the area of ten (10) pounds. Must be able to move about the classroom and monitor student behavior.
